Pupils enrolled in upper secondary education by programme orientation, sex, type of institution and intensity of participation in 2016

  • Value: 350,734 people
  • Change vs 2015: −6,802 people (−1.9 %)
  • Position in history: below the 12-year average (average — 353,688.42 people)
  • Series maximum — 369,842 people in 2013 (3 years ago)
  • Series minimum — 346,135 people in 2018
  • Value date: 1 January 2016
  • Source: Eurostat
